GRAHAM PLEASED WITH CREATION OF
RIGHTS & DEMOCRACY NETWORK
Minister of Foreign Affairs Bill Graham reiterated his support for the creation of the
Rights & Democracy Network, a Canada-wide forum for students interested in taking
concrete action in the area of human rights.
"We are pleased with the creation of the Rights & Democracy Network," said
Minister Graham at the opening ceremony in Quebec City this afternoon. "This Network
will enable students to come together to hold discussions with the Canadian and
international community on issues of great concern to the public, in particular human
rights, democratic development and globalization."
The purpose of the Network is to promote the United Nations International Bill of
Human Rights and democratic practices in Canada and around the world. The Network
is composed of delegations of students from Canadian universities and colleges,
individuals and institutions committed to promoting human rights and democratic
development.
"This student network provides a wonderful opportunity to recognize the contribution of
young people to human rights issues. I therefore reaffirm the Canadian government's
interest in this initiative and encourage Rights & Democracy to promote the growth of
delegations in Canada," the Minister added.
